VETCLARITY LTD
13402590

CompanyNameVETCLARITY LTD
CompanyNumber13402590
RegAddress
AddressLine130 OLD ROAD
AddressLine2WALGRAVE
PostTownNORTHAMPTON
CountryENGLAND
PostcodeNN6 9QW
CompanyCategoryPrivate Limited Company
CompanyStatusActive
CountryOfOriginUnited Kingdom
IncorporationDate17/05/2021
Accounts
AccountRefDay05
AccountRefMonth04
NextDueDate05/01/2025
LastMadeUpDate05/04/2023
AccountCategoryMICRO
Returns
NextDueDate30/05/2024
LastMadeUpDate16/05/2023
SICCodes
SicText75000 - Veterinary activities
Department for Business, Innovation and Skills